Does the Procurement and Logistics Division conduct purchases for the whole UN system?

0

No. The Procurement and Logistics Division procures only for UNRWA and its Field Offices. The Field Offices also have delegated authorities to carry out their own local procurement up to established financial limits. Purchases beyond these limits are conducted by the Procurement and Logistics Division in Headquarters, Amman. Other UN agencies, funds, and programmes carry out their own procurement activities within their own established rules.
